To all the current pcom pharmacy students, what are classes like? And what is the current status with accreditation? Wasn't the board supposed to meet sometime last month and decide whether they would grant candidate status or not?

Hey! Classes are generally from 8-12 everyday. We had lab once a week each term from 1-4, and rotations once a week from 1-5 during winter and spring term. I'm not sure what time your classes will be, but plan on 4 hours a day.

As far as accreditation, ACPE visited back in April and we should know the candidate status decision this summer :)
